Born in Chicago and raised in Pasadena, California, Wesley Thompson began his career on the stage. He was voted Best Actor in college for his leading role in prolific playwright and director George C. Wolfe's very first play, "Up For Grabs". Since receiving his degree in Theater Arts from San Francisco State University & Cal State Los Angeles, he's performed all over the Southland in such roles as Honey in "A Member of the Wedding" (with the legendary Virginia Capers), convicted felon Ice in Miguel Pinero's prison drama "Short Eyes", and in three long-running productions at West LA's Odyssey Theater: Filtch in Molière's "The Miser" with George Murdock, soldier McGlade in a Vietnam drama, "The Bridgehead", directed by Stephen Tobolowsky, and wisecracking relief pitcher Duke in the baseball comedy hit, "Bullpen", which moved, after its initial run, to Boston's Hasty Pudding Theater at Harvard. He has since gone on to do dozens of plays all over, but none as rewarding as his supporting role as the lovable loan shark Jumbo in the 2000 production of the romantic-comedy "Panache". It opened at the Pasadena Playhouse but within two months was swiftly moved to off-Broadway, to the Players Theater in Greenwich Village, in which The New York Times called Wesley "an electric, on-stage presence".

His television roles are too numerous to mention. From The White Shadow (1978) to The Larry Sanders Show (1992) to Seinfeld (1989), he has done most of the best shows. He was a series regular on two ABC programs: He's the Mayor (1986) and Pursuit of Happiness (1987). His most recent stints include Friends (1994), Providence (1999), Voilà ! (1997), Malcolm (2000) and recurring roles on Urgences (1994) and Parents à tout prix (2001). He has been very fortunate to have done over 200 commercials over the years.

His first audition for film was for a low-budget drama intended as a documentary where the actors had to be believed as real people. The director, a young newcomer to feature filmmaking, hired him on the spot. The director was Taylor Hackford (Officier et gentleman (1982), L'Associé du diable (1997)). The film, Teenage Father (1978), won the Academy Award as Best Live Action Short. From there Wesley has never looked back, working in the Walter Hill film Comment claquer un million de dollars par jour? (1985) with Richard Pryor and John Candy, Gremlins 2 : La Nouvelle Génération (1990), directed by Joe Dante and working alongside Alfre Woodard in the Ivan Passer film Pretty Hattie's Baby (1991). Other film roles include the stage manager in Mick Jackson's, Los Angeles Story (1991) with Steve Martin; Christina Ricci's teacher, Mr. Curtis, in the Brad Silberling-directed/Steven Spielberg-produced Casper (1995); as John Travolta's boss in Desmond Nakano's White Man (1995) with Harry Belafonte and the winner of the Discovery Award at the 1999 Toronto Film Festival, Goat on Fire and Smiling Fish (1999) produced by Martin Scorsese. He was last seen with Vivica A. Fox in L'amour n'est qu'un jeu (2001) written and directed by Mark Brown (writer of Barbershop (2002)).
